Seeking an FP&A Analyst to join a thriving Accounting & Finance department in the Technology & Telecoms industry. The role involves financial planning, reporting, and providing business insight to support decision-making. You will also need to have experience of financial modelling.

Client Details

Our client is a prominent player in the Technology & Telecoms industry, boasting a fantastic global workforce. They excel at providing innovative solutions and are leading within their industry.

Description

  • Drive the financial planning and forecasting process.
  • Deliver detailed financial reports and presentations to senior management.
  • Provide business insight and analysis to support decision-making.
  • Collaborate with various business units to gather and validate budget inputs.
  • Assist in the preparation of the company's annual budget.
  • Identify and implement process improvements to enhance financial visibility and control.
  • Support ad-hoc financial projects as required.
  • Ensure compliance with the company's financial policies and procedures.

Profile

A successful FP&A Analyst should have:

  • ACA qualification preferred.
  • Proficiency in financial modelling and forecasting.
  • Strong analytical skills, with an ability to interpret complex financial data.
  • Excellent communication skills, with the ability to present financial information in a clear and concise manner.
  • Experience working in a fast-paced, dynamic business environment.
  • A proactive approach to problem-solving.
